Decoding the the German automaker's Wheel Emblem: Background & Significance

The iconic BMW steering wheel emblem is far more a simple badge; it’s a layered representation of the brand’s heritage. Initially appearing in 1923, the emblem showcases a divided blue and white pattern taken directly from the Bavarian flag. Before BMW began building automobiles, it was known as Rapp Motor Works and later Bayerische Flugzeugwerke, creating aircraft propellers – and the emblem served as its original logo during that era. The subsequent addition of the BMW symbol encircled by a dark ring represents the propeller of an propeller plane, giving homage to the organization's aviation roots. Over the years , the emblem’s style has experienced minor alterations , but its fundamental meaning and visual have persisted largely consistent .

Replacing Your BMW Steering Wheel: A Step-by-Step Guide

Changing your BMW's steering wheel can be a satisfying project, personalizing the look and feel of your vehicle. This process outlines the important steps, even if requiring some mechanical aptitude . Before you start , gather the required tools: a screwdriver assortment, possibly a Torx bit, a trim tool , and, of course, your replacement steering wheel. First, remove the battery's negative terminal to prevent potential airbag deployment. Next, carefully use the trim tool to loosen the upper and lower steering wheel covers. Then, unscrew the center airbag module, respecting the manufacturer’s instructions – this is a crucial safety precaution! The steering wheel itself is secured by a fastener; unscrew this while holding the wheel. Once removed, disconnect the airbag connectors and any present clock spring connectors. Finally, install your new wheel, repeating the steps in reverse order, verifying all connections are solid. Always consult your BMW’s repair handbook for specific instructions.
